About this clipart
The image uses a 2D grid to represent spacetime, showing three increasingly massive objects-Sun (yellow sphere), neutron star (small blue sphere), and black hole (black dot)-each warping the fabric beneath it. As mass increases, the curvature intensifies: the Sun causes mild depression, the neutron star forms a narrow, steep well, and the black hole produces an inescapable vertical plunge ending in a singularity. This visualization helps convey Einstein’s general relativity concept that gravity arises from geometry.
